DART

Dynamically Adaptive Response Technology (DART) is a SpeechCycle patent-pending technique for more elegantly recovering from low confidence recognition in Natural Language Speech Applications. DART is able to confirm back to callers what appears to be understanding of at least some of what a caller is trying to convey. For example:

Without DART – “order PPV” [Low confidence] reprompt – “What can I help you with?”

With DART – “order PPV” [Low confidence] reprompt – “I understand you would like to place and order, would you like to order PPV or On-demand?”

Note that the NLU application did not previously traverse a dialog that included “ordering” as would have been likely in a directed dialog application.
